Regenerative Braking
Whenever Model 3 is moving and your foot is
off the accelerator, regenerative braking slows
down Model 3 and feeds any surplus energy back to the Battery.
By anticipating your stops and reducing or
removing pressure from the accelerator pedal
to slow down, you can take advantage of regenerative braking to increase driving range.
Of course, this is no substitute for regular braking when needed for safety.
Note: If regenerative braking is aggressively
slowing Model 3 (such as when your foot is
completely off the accelerator pedal at
highway speeds), the brake lights turn on to
alert others that you are slowing down.
Note: Installing winter tires with aggressive
compound and tread design may result in
temporarily-reduced regenerative braking
power. However, your vehicle is designed to continuously recalibrate itself, and after changing tires it will increasingly restore
regenerative braking power after some
moderate-torque straight-line accelerations.
For most drivers this occurs after a short
period of normal driving, but drivers who
normally accelerate lightly may need to use
slightly harder accelerations while the
recalibration is in progress.
Warning: In snowy or icy conditions
Model 3 may experience traction loss
during regenerative braking, particularly
when in the Standard setting and/or not
using winter tires. Tesla recommends
using the Low setting (see To Set the
Regenerative Braking Level on page 66)
in snowy or icy conditions to help maintain vehicle stability.The amount of energy fed back to the Battery
using regenerative braking can depend on the
current state of the Battery and the charge
level setting that you are using. For example,
regenerative braking may be limited if the Battery is already fully charged or if the
ambient temperature is too cold.
Note: If regenerative braking is limited, a
dashed line displays on the energy bar (see
Driving Status on page 63).

Model 3 brake pads are equipped with wear indicators. A wear indicator is a thin metal
strip attached to the brake pad that squeals as
it rubs against the rotor when the pad wears
down. This squealing sound indicates that the
brake pads have reached the end of their service life and require replacement. To
replace the brake pads, contact Tesla Service.
Brakes must be periodically inspected visually by removing the tire and wheel. For detailed
specifications and service limits for rotors and
brake pads, see Subsystems on page 188.
Additionally, Tesla recommends cleaning and
lubricating the brake calipers every year or
12,500 miles (20,000 km) if in an area where
roads are salted during winter months.Warning: Neglecting to replace worn
brake pads damages the braking system
and can result in a braking hazard.

Regenerative Braking
Regenerative braking may be limited if the Battery is too cold. As you continue to drive,
the Battery warms up and regenerative power
increases (see Regenerative Braking on page
66).
Note: Limited regenerative braking can be
avoided if you allow enough time to precondition your vehicle or use scheduleddeparture before your drive, as mentioned
previously.
Note: Installing winter tires may result in
temporarily reduced regenerative braking
power but Model 3 will recalibrate itself to correct this after a short period of driving.

Summer Tires
Your vehicle may be originally equipped with high performance summer tires or all season
tires. Tesla recommends using winter tires if
driving in cold temperatures or on roads
where snow or ice may be present. Contact
Tesla for winter tire recommendations.Warning: In cold temperatures or on snow
or ice, summer tires do not provide
adequate traction. Selecting and installing the appropriate tires for winter conditions
is important to ensure the safety and
optimum performance of your Model 3.
All-Season Tires
Your Model 3 may be originally equipped with all-season tires. These tires are designed to
provide adequate traction in most conditions
year-round, but may not provide the same level of traction as winter tires in snowy or icy
conditions. All-season tires can be identified
by “ALL SEASON" and/or "M+S” (mud and
snow) on the tire sidewall.
Winter Tires
Use winter tires to increase traction in snowy
or icy conditions. When installing winter tires,
always install a complete set of four tires at
the same time. Winter tires must be the same
diameter, brand, construction and tread
pattern on all four wheels. Contact Tesla for
winter tire recommendations.

Uniform Tire Quality GradingThe following information relates to the tire
grading system developed by the National
Highway Traffic Safety Administration
(NHTSA), which grades tires by tread wear,
traction and temperature performance. Tires
that have deep tread, and winter tires, are
exempt from these marking requirements.
